Experience Overview
See Paris icons such as the Champs-Elysees, taste pintxos in San Sebastian and watch Venetian glassblowers shape molten glass by hand. This grand European tour travels from Parisian avenues and Bordeaux’s celebrated wine country to Gaudi’s extraordinary La Sagrada Familia in Barcelona. Along the French Riviera, follow Nice’s Promenade des Anglais and see Monaco’s harbor lined with luxury yachts. In Vienna, palaces and grand boulevards trace the legacy of Austria’s Habsburg dynasty.

Head southwards towards Châteaux Country. Take a scenic drive along the Loire Valley,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The region is known as the Jardins de France for the beautifully maintained gardens created on vast estates as outdoor living areas. Visit the majestic Chenonceau Castle, an elegant French château spanning the River Cher. Continue on to the bustling in-land port of Bordeaux with its unique 18th-century character.
Accommodation: Novotel Gare St. Jean, Bordeaux
Meals: Breakfast
You’ll join a Local Expert for a walking tour through Bordeaux, where pale 18th-century façades line the quays and the Grand Theater stands at the heart of the Triangle d’Or. Continue to the Esplanade des Quinconces and learn why much of the city is rec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Spend the rest of the day exploring Bordeaux at your own pace or join an Optional Experience to Saint-Émilion. Travel through the vineyards to a Bordelaise château for a tour of the cellars and a tasting of local wines. You’ll also visit Saint-Émilion and its UNESCO-listed monolithic church, carved directly into the limestone.

Leave San Sebastián and travel along the western Pyrenees to Pamplona, the historic capital of Navarre. Explore Plaza del Castillo and step inside Cafe Iruña, where tiled floors, ornate mirrors and dark wood recall the 1920s and Ernest Hemingway’s visits to the city. Continue past Zaragoza and across the plains of Aragón, stopping for lunch along the way before arriving in Barcelona in the late afternoon.

Wake up ready to rub shoulders with the jet set on the glamorous Côte d’Azur, a stretch of coastline long favored by artists, aristocrats and film stars. Enjoy a drive along part of Monaco’s famous Grand Prix circuit, where the roar of Formula 1 cars has echoed through the principality since 1929. With Insight Choice, take your pick; step inside the Oceanographic Museum, founded by Prince Albert I in 1910 and home to over 6,000 marine species, or visit the Royal Palace of Monaco and see the 19th-century Monaco Cathedral, final resting place of Princess Grace. Cross into Italy and follow the arc of the Italian Riviera before arriving in Pisa. In the Square of Miracles, stop to see the incredible Leaning Tower of Pisa with a Local Expert, from which Galileo is said to have conducted experiments on velocity and gravity. Also see the splendid 11th-century cathedral and baptistery, decorated with mosaics and designs in solid marble. Continue through Tuscany to the captivating city of Florence.

In the morning, there is the option to join a private tour of Maria Theresa's Schönbrunn Palace and formal gardens. Later, get your camera ready for a drive around the famous Ring Road. This grand boulevard, built alongside the lines of the old city walls, showcases many of the capital’s architectural masterpieces, including the Opera House, magnificent Hofburg Imperial Residence and Parliament. Later, join your Local Expert for a walk through Innere Stadt, the first district and historic core of Vienna. Visit a traditional Viennese cafe to enjoy local specialties of coffee and Sachertorte or visit Capuchins Crypt, the burial place of the Habsburg family in Vienna.

Pass the impressive Benedictine monastery of Melk before reaching the enchanting city of Salzburg, birthplace of Mozart and the iconic musical 'The Sound of Music'. A Local Expert will show you the formal gardens of Mirabell Palace, including the fountains and statues where the 'Do, Re, Mi' scene was filmed. Cross Residence Square with its fountain, where Maria sings 'I Have Confidence' and see the imposing fortress, the immense cathedral and Mozart’s birthplace on the lively Getreidegasse. Perhaps join an excursion to the famous Eagle's Nest? Continue to the mountain ringed Tyrolean capital of Innsbruck to see the Golden Roof and Imperial Palace.

Journey past flower-filled meadows and picturesque chalet-style villages to the Principality of Liechtenstein. Spend some time in its tiny capital, Vaduz, then cross into Switzerland and through glorious mountains to lakeside Lucerne. On arrival, visit Lucerne's proud Lion Monument, carved into a limestone cliff and dedicated to the heroic Swiss Guards who died defending King Louis XVI during the French Revolution. Part of The Travel Company (TTC) family of brands, Insight Vacations began operations in 1978 and is based in Cypress, CA. Journeys are featured to destinations, such as the U.S. and Canada, Europe, Latin America, North Africa, Asia, the UK and Ireland. The company offers are a variety of tours under the classifications of Regional Journeys, Country Roads, Discovery Journeys, Easy Pace trips, and Special Interest tours. Insight is the ideal name for the tour operator, as the journeys provided by Insight Vacations allow travelers to gain further insight into whatever destination they wish to explore. For example, Discovery Journeys are the ideal choice for first-time visitors to Europe. Itineraries include Dine-at-Home or Farm-to-Table experiences so travelers can learn more about how locals live and dine. Regional Journeys allow trip-goers to see a specific location in Europe that they have always wanted to see – Poland, Switzerland, Italy, etc. The carefully planned trips enable customers to immerse themselves in one specific region or country and to become acquainted with its culture, traditions, and people. For anyone seeking travel off the beaten track, Insight Vacations offers Country Roads – trips that lead travelers off the well-tread tourist trail to explore hidden gems where visitors can savor the local produce with Farm-to-Table dining. Some trips are offered under the Easy Pace travel style – the ideal trip choice for trip-goers who wish to slow their pace during their vacation. During these tours, vacationers stay at least 3 nights at each destination, giving them some additional time to explore a place and enjoy it. Regardless of the travel style, many of the vacations offered by Insight Vacations begin with Relaxed Starts – giving travelers time to sleep in a little, spend more time at breakfast, or explore an area on their own. The tour company prides itself on providing business class tours that features luxury coaches with 40 seats. While most coach touring operators provide vehicles with 53 seats, Insight Vacations has re-configured its motor coaches to hold up to 40 guests. This gives passengers extra leg room while traveling and offers them more space and privacy.
